Offensive line recognized by D3football.com

SALISBURY, Md. - The Salisbury University offensive line paved the way for a 400-yard rushing effort last Saturday afternoon against No. 20 Christopher Newport University and for their effort the unit was recognized by D3football.com as they each garnered a spot on the Team of the Week.

Josh Berman, Jeremy McKinney, Bryan Burdalski, David Preston and Chris Reeves opened the holes and allowed the Sea Gull offense to post their highest offensive output of the season (433 total yards). The Sea Gulls had one 100-yard rusher, two more players run for over 80 yards and they scored all five touchdowns on the ground.

The Sea Gulls' 35-21 win over then No. 20 Christopher Newport propelled Salisbury to No. 18 in the country in the first American Football Coaches Association poll released earlier this week.

SU has started 3-0 for the first time since 2005 and will look to continue its momentum as it hosts Delaware Valley College on Saturday, September 22, at 1 p.m. at Sea Gull Stadium.
